| Aspect | Senior Cad Designer | CAD Technician |
|---|
| Credentials | Bachelor's degree in design, engineering, or related field; extensive experience | Associate degree or certification in CAD software; less experience required |
| Responsibilities | Lead design projects, develop complex drawings, oversee design standards | Prepare detailed drawings, update existing plans, assist in drafting tasks |
| Work Environment | Design firms, engineering companies, architecture firms | Architectural, engineering, or construction teams |
| Experience Level | 5+ years, leadership in projects | 1-3 years, support role |
The main difference between a Senior Cad Designer and a CAD Technician lies in experience, responsibilities, and leadership. Senior Cad Designers typically lead projects and develop complex designs, while CAD Technicians focus on drafting and supporting design tasks. Both roles are essential in design and engineering industries, but the Senior Cad Designer holds a more advanced, supervisory position.
